Nolensville, Tennessee has grown from a quiet 1797 farming settlement into one of the most beloved small towns in Williamson County, all while holding onto its hometown character. Tucked roughly 20 to 25 minutes southeast of downtown Nashville along Nolensville Road, the town wraps around a historic Main Street that follows Mill Creek, lined with the old feed mill, antique shops, family restaurants, and the Historic Nolensville School Museum. Newer rooftops in Bent Creek and Scales Farmstead now sit alongside that history, drawing families and professionals who want room to breathe without leaving Nashville behind.

IV therapy delivers fluids, vitamins, and minerals directly into your bloodstream at 100% bioavailability, skipping the digestive system entirely. That means faster, fuller results than any oral supplement, sports drink, or multivitamin can offer.
